Working principle
For example, our hot melt film commonly used in the field of clothing, in fact, also involves plastic products. Because of the variety of clothing fabrics. Natural materials are cotton, hemp, silk and so on. There are natural synthetic, that is, chemical fibers. Chemical fiber is actually a plastic product, because it is also extracted from petroleum, but it is eventually made into textiles, and it is essentially no different from plastic.
So, you have to ask, can plastic be bonded using hot melt adhesive film? The answer must be yes, and in fact, in a broad sense, hot melt film has been widely used in plastic products. So, in a narrow sense, can the plastic products we usually see be bonded with hot melt adhesive film? That's another question.
The material characteristics of different plastics are actually very different, and some plastics are very difficult to bond, especially some plastic products with relatively high oil content, such as polytetrafluoroethylene, is a plastic that is difficult to bond. However, for ordinary plastic products, Polypropylene Thermoplastic Film is usually possible to find adhesive solutions, and it is also feasible to find hot melt adhesive film to bond. For example, PVC plastic can try to use TPU hot melt adhesive film to bond, while PE plastic and PP plastic can usually try to use PO hot melt adhesive film products to bond.

Product Usage Method
Hot melt adhesive film divide into the Hot melt film with release paper and hot melt adhesive without release paper.
Hot melt film with release paper is generally adopted by the preparation process. First, the hot melt adhesive film surface with the release paper or release film is attached to one of the materials that need to be composite, and the rapid composite under low pressure and low temperature conditions, so that the film product and the composite material are initially bonded together and reserved for other use. Before composite with another material, strip the release paper or release film, and then give a certain pressure and temperature, after the process required time, the product can be naturally cooled to compound the two materials.
Hot melt film without release paper is also often called bare mold because it is not attached to the release paper or release film. The substrate free hot melt film is usually compounded between materials by paving method. When composite, the baseless hot melt adhesive film is paved between the two materials that need to be bonded, and after giving a certain pressure and temperature, the two materials can be combined together after natural cooling after the process is specified. Continuous operation can be achieved when the substrate free hot melt film is used to compound coil products.
